One answer may be correct Special cells in the body are responsible for gathering information about the body's environment. These cells are called receptor cells. The information gathered by receptor cells is encoded as electrical signals that travel along the body's nerve cells. The brain and spinal cord then process the electrical signals to determine how the body should respond
